Maryland to Louisiana Car Shipping (2026 Cost Guide)

Quick answer: On average, shipping a car 1,200 miles from Maryland to Louisiana ranges from $906 to $1,400. Expect the trip to take around two–eight days, depending on the transport method you choose and seasonal demand. For a detailed breakdown, use our car shipping cost calculator.

How we chose the best car shipping companies

We analyzed 2,400 car shipping companies nationally and evaluated and rated them based on key factors using our unique system of methodology.

Here’s what we considered:

  • Standard services: We looked at the types and variety of services each company provides. This includes whether they offer open transport, enclosed transport, or both. We also rated companies based on whether they have door-to-door shipping or just terminal pickup and delivery and the kinds of vehicles they ship. Companies that move RVs, motorcycles, and other specialty vehicles scored higher than those that just ship cars.
  • Add-on services: We gave additional points to companies that provide special optional services like expedited shipping, guaranteed pickup times, car washes, and rental car reimbursement.
  • Customer satisfaction: We analyzed consumer reviews on multiple major platforms, such as Yelp, Google, and Trustpilot to see whether a car shipping company delivers services promptly with good communication and within the estimated cost. We also evaluated each company’s standing within the car shipping industry as a whole by confirming U.S. Department of Transportation (USDOT) licensure and checked their membership in — and reputation with — trade associations.
  • Availability: We awarded points to each company based on their service areas. Companies that are available in Alaska and Hawaii, in addition to the continental U.S., scored higher than those that just service the Lower 48 or fewer states.
  • Scheduling and payment: We reviewed the ease with which customers can schedule services and estimate their costs through accurate quotes, price matching, flat-rate pricing, and other perks. Car shippers that give binding quotes or a price-lock promise got more positive rankings than those that are not as transparent with pricing.

Maryland to Louisiana auto transport costs and transit times

The tables below highlight the average shipping costs and estimated timelines for transporting a car between popular cities in Maryland and Louisiana. The trip typically spans 1,200 miles and takes about two–eight days.

Cost to ship a car from Washington DC, MD to Louisiana

From Maryland to Louisiana Cost Distance Estimated transit time
Washington DC, MD to New Orleans, LA $818 – $1,308 1,084 miles 2 – 8 days
Washington DC, MD to Baton Rouge, LA $847 – $1,394 1,142 miles 2 – 8 days
Washington DC, MD to Shreveport, LA $847 – $1,326 1,193 miles 2 – 8 days
Washington DC, MD to Metairie, LA $786 – $1,283 1,088 miles 2 – 8 days
Washington DC, MD to Lafayette, LA $847 – $1,367 1,195 miles 2 – 8 days

Cost to ship a car from Baltimore, MD to Louisiana

From Maryland to Louisiana Cost Distance Estimated transit time
Baltimore, MD to New Orleans, LA $856 – $1,421 1,122 miles 2 – 8 days
Baltimore, MD to Baton Rouge, LA $873 – $1,421 1,179 miles 2 – 8 days
Baltimore, MD to Shreveport, LA $943 – $1,429 1,230 miles 2 – 8 days
Baltimore, MD to Metairie, LA $839 – $1,421 1,126 miles 2 – 8 days
Baltimore, MD to Lafayette, LA $962 – $1,429 1,233 miles 2 – 8 days

Shipping an SUV or truck from Maryland to Louisiana

SUVs, trucks, and vans typically cost more to ship than smaller cars because of their size and weight.

For a larger vehicle going from Maryland to Louisiana, the price usually falls between $1,133 and $1,750.

Factors that affect car shipping costs from Maryland to Louisiana

Transporting your vehicle from the Old Line State to the Pelican State comes with a number of cost considerations, including:

  • Type of transport: Open carriers are the most economical, while enclosed transport offers greater protection for valuable or classic cars. Another option you might want to consider is top-loading. For a detailed comparison, see our guide on open vs. enclosed shipping.
  • Vehicle size and type: Larger vehicles that weigh more are costlier to ship. This directly affects pricing for transport to Louisiana.
  • Distance and route: The journey from Maryland to Louisiana spans about 1,200 miles. More miles mean more fuel and labor, raising the cost.
  • Time of the year: Seasonal demand impacts the price of getting your car out of Maryland, with summer and winter holidays often seeing a spike due to increased moving and travel activity.
  • Fuel prices: Varying fuel costs across the country can affect shipping rates. When transporting your car from Maryland to Louisiana, you may see the effect of these fluctuations.
  • Delivery expectations: Flexible delivery dates may lower your rate. The standard shipping time is two–eight days, but you can pay for expedited service.

Louisiana vehicle regulations you need to know

Once you arrive in Louisiana, registering your vehicle and ensuring it’s road-legal will require a few specific actions. The list below outlines the most important requirements.

  • Car insurance requirements: The insurance limit represents the maximum payout for a claim, and in Louisiana, the minimum liability limits are $15,000 for bodily injury per person, $30,000 for bodily injury per accident, and $25,000 for property damage; these limits can be raised beyond the state-mandated minimums.
  • Vehicle inspection: In Louisiana, the annual safety and emissions inspection includes checks on the vehicle's safety equipment, anti-tampering of emissions systems, and a test on the integrity of the gas cap.
  • Driver’s license: New residents in Louisiana must transfer their out-of-state driver's license within 30 days of establishing residency in the state.
  • Additional taxes: In Louisiana, a 4% tax is levied on all car sales by the state, with additional taxes charged by individual counties and cities.

FAQ

Does someone have to be present when you ship a car for pickup in Maryland and delivery in Louisiana?

Most companies will require that an adult of at least 18 years of age be present when picking up your car in Maryland and when dropping it off in Louisiana.

Do you need car insurance when shipping your car from Maryland to Louisiana?

If you’re not driving the vehicle from Maryland to Louisiana, you aren't required to have typical car insurance. Your car hauler should have adequate insurance if an accident happened on the drive to Louisiana, which you should verify before loading your car in Maryland.

If you’re driving your car at all in either state, you should understand the requirements. All vehicles in Maryland must maintain insurance coverage from a Maryland-licensed insurance company at all times, with mandatory minimum coverage of $30,000 for bodily injury per person, $60,000 for multiple people, and $15,000 for property damage.

The insurance limit represents the maximum payout for a claim, and in Louisiana, the minimum liability limits are $15,000 for bodily injury per person, $30,000 for bodily injury per accident, and $25,000 for property damage; these limits can be raised beyond the state-mandated minimums.

How long does it take to ship a car from Maryland to Louisiana?

Car shipping companies can travel about 500 miles per day. The trip from Maryland to Louisiana is about 1,200 miles, and that’s as fast as about 3 days. However, most car transport companies will take two to eight days to travel from Maryland to Louisiana.
